"Si un trabajador quiere hacer bien su trabajo, primero debe afilar sus herramientas." - Confucio, "Las Analectas de Confucio. Lu Linggong"
Página delantera > Programación > 10 Biblioteca de dibujo y lienzo de JavaScript Cool

10 Biblioteca de dibujo y lienzo de JavaScript Cool

Publicado el 2025-04-29
Navegar:788

Este artículo explora varias bibliotecas de JavaScript para las funcionalidades de dibujo y lienzo, lo que permite a los desarrolladores web a mejorar sus aplicaciones con gráficos dinámicos. ¡Profundicemos en estas poderosas herramientas! Actualizado 18/05/2013: consulta de lona agregada.

  1. ocanvas: Esta biblioteca JavaScript simplifica el desarrollo de lienzo HTML5 usando objetos en lugar de píxeles, proporcionando un punto de entrada intuitivo y accesible.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. Drawing Lines (Mozilla e IE): Dado que HTML carece de capacidades inherentes de dibujo de líneas, este ejemplo aprovecha el algoritmo de Bresenham en JavaScript, ofreciendo una representación de línea eficiente en los navegadores mientras minimiza el consumo de recursos.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. Canviz: Canviz ofrece una ventaja de rendimiento sobre la generación de mapa de bits del lado del servidor para aplicaciones web. Agiliza el proceso al hacer que el servidor genere solo texto XDOT, lo que resulta en una representación más rápida.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. flotr: flotr facilita la creación de gráficos visualmente atractivos en los navegadores modernos con una sintaxis fácil de usar. Cuenta con características como soporte de leyendas, manejo de valor negativo, seguimiento del mouse, zoom y amplias opciones de estilo.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. Raphael: Aprovechando SVG y VML, Raphael crea gráficos que también son objetos DOM, lo que permite un fácil manejo y modificación de eventos. Su compatibilidad y facilidad de uso del navegador cruzado lo convierte en una opción versátil.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. canvasgraph.js: diseñado para trazar gráfico directo dentro del navegador, Canvasgraph.js ofrece una solución simple sin dependencias externas.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. jsdraw2d: jsdraw2d admite características avanzadas de dibujo, incluidas las curvas cúbicas y generales de Bezier de diversos grados, lo que permite la creación de curvas abiertas y cerradas.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. JavaScript Vector-Draw Library: Esta biblioteca de navegador cruzado prioriza la velocidad, aunque reconoce las limitaciones de rendimiento inherentes del dibujo de la página web basada en JavaScript en comparación con aplicaciones independientes.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. dibujo2d: Draw2d proporciona una interfaz fácil de usar para crear dibujos y diagramas directamente dentro del navegador, eliminando la necesidad de software o complementos adicionales.

10 Cool JavaScript Drawing and Canvas Libraries fuente & demo

  1. consulta de lona: Esta biblioteca extiende el lienzo HTML5, ofreciendo a los desarrolladores de juegos Configuración simplificada para bucles de juegos, representación y manejo de entrada (mouse, touch, teclado).

(nota: He reemplazado a los marcadores de posición entre corchetes con instrucciones para agregar enlaces a la fuente real y las páginas de demostración. Deberá encontrar e insertar los enlaces correctos para cada biblioteca.)

La siguiente sección contiene preguntas frecuentes sobre el dibujo de JavaScript y las bibliotecas de lienzo. (Esta sección permanece en gran medida sin cambios, ya que ya está bien escrita y no necesita paráfrasis significativas). Las preguntas y respuestas se tratan de elegir bibliotecas, crear dibujos interactivos, visualización de datos, opciones de código abierto y más. (La sección de preguntas frecuentes se omite para la brevedad según lo solicitado, pero se incluiría en la salida final.)

Último tutorial Más>

Descargo de responsabilidad: Todos los recursos proporcionados provienen en parte de Internet. Si existe alguna infracción de sus derechos de autor u otros derechos e intereses, explique los motivos detallados y proporcione pruebas de los derechos de autor o derechos e intereses y luego envíelos al correo electrónico: [email protected]. Lo manejaremos por usted lo antes posible.

Copyright© 2022 湘ICP备2022001581号-3